About the Company
Our Client is an early stage biotech start-up founded by Ex Google and PhD Genetic Editing, ENS, working on the first generation of bioengineered plants to fight air pollution. They start with indoor air pollution, which is up to 5 times higher than outdoors and due to a specific type of pollutants called VOCs. They create plants that can effectively remediate these compounds in your home. Their longer term ambition is to leverage our technologies for other large scale applications such as carbon capture and storage for example. They are backed by top tier Silicon Valley and European investors and are currently based in Paris, France.
